Polar Bears, Islands and Fjords ( Spitsbergen - Bergen)

This is a voyage loaded with highlights from Svalbard and Norway. After exploring the natural wonders of Spitsbergen we head south to Hurtigruten’s homeland of Norway with its incredible scenery, charming towns and friendly people.

Itinerary SPITSBERGEN – BERGEN Day 1, Longyearbyen

Our adventure starts in Longyearbyen, with an overnight stay at the Spitsbergen Hotel.

DAY 2, Longyearbyen and Barentsburg

We embark MS Nordstjernen. In the Russian settlement of Barentsburg, you can enjoy a lively folklore show.

DAY 3, Magdalenefjord and Moffen

Magdalenefjord is one of the beautiful fjords in this area that we will aim to visit.

DAY 4, Ny-Ålesund

Ny-Ålesund was the starting point for numerous expeditions towards the North Pole.

DAY 5, Bjørnøya

We will marvel at the spectacular, towering cliffs of this island before heading south towards the Norwegian mainland.

DAY 6, Honningsvåg

Honningsvåg is situated at 70°58’ N on Magerøya. Here you find the well-known North Cape (optional excursion).

DAY 7, Tromsø – gateway to the Arctic

Tromsø is a lively, colourful city, surrounded by the picturesque Lyngen Alps.

DAY 8, Trollfjord and Svolvær

We sail through the spectacular, narrow Raftsund before hopefully entering the magnificent Trollfjord. Later we will call at Svolvær, which is the regional centre of the Lofoten Islands.

DAY 9, Alstahaug and Vega

Alstahaug has a population of about 7,500 inhabitants spread across 917 islands and islets. The Vega archipelago is a cluster of UNESCO-listed islands.

DAY 10, Brekstad

Close to Brekstad we find Austrått Manor, one of the oldest manors in Norway, dating back as far as the Viking period. The manor is now managed by The National Museum of Decorative Arts.

DAY 11, Ålesund and Geiranger

Ålesund is renowned for its charming Art Nouveau architecture. The Geirangerfjord is one of Norway’s most popular tourist destinations and has been a UNESCO World Heritage Site since 2005.

DAY 12, Olden, Nordfjord

We sail into Nordfjord to Jostedalsbreen, Europe’s largest mainland glacier. We travel through Utfjord and Innviksfjord to reach Olden.

DAY 13, Bergen

We arrive at the port of Bergen during the morning. Enjoy the day in this international city with small-town charm, surrounded by seven impressive mountains.
